问小白 wenxiaobai
资讯
历史
科技
环境与自然
成长
游戏
财经
文学与艺术
美食
健康
家居
文化
情感
汽车
三农
军事
旅行
运动
教育
生活
星座命理

Excel怎么直接显示超链接的图片

创作时间:
作者:
@小白创作中心

Excel怎么直接显示超链接的图片

引用
1
来源
1.
https://docs.pingcode.com/baike/4845994

在Excel中直接显示超链接的图片,可以极大地提升数据的可视化效果。本文将详细介绍三种实现方法:使用公式与函数、使用VBA代码、插入对象。其中,使用公式与函数是最为简便和灵活的方法,尤其适合Excel最新版本的用户。

Excel直接显示超链接的图片的方法包括:使用公式与函数、使用VBA代码、插入对象。其中,最常见和有效的方法是使用公式与函数。通过使用公式与函数,您可以动态地显示超链接的图片内容,这为数据管理和展示提供了极大的便利。下面将详细介绍这种方法。

一、使用公式与函数

使用公式与函数来直接显示超链接的图片是最为简便和灵活的方法。主要步骤如下:

1.1 插入图片链接

首先,在Excel表格中插入包含图片链接的单元格。通常,我们会将这些图片链接放在专门的一列中,以便后续操作。

1.2 使用IMAGE函数

在Excel的最新版本(Microsoft 365)中,可以使用IMAGE函数来直接显示超链接的图片。语法如下:

=IMAGE(url, [alt_text], [width], [height], [mode])  

其中:

  • url 是图片的链接地址。
  • alt_text 是图片的替代文本(可选)。
  • width 和 height 是图片的宽度和高度(可选)。
  • mode 是显示模式(可选)。

例如,如果图片链接在A1单元格中,可以在B1单元格中输入以下公式来显示图片:

=IMAGE(A1)  

二、使用VBA代码

VBA(Visual Basic for Applications)代码提供了更为灵活和强大的方法来直接显示超链接的图片。以下是详细步骤:

2.1 打开VBA编辑器

按下 Alt + F11 打开VBA编辑器。

2.2 插入模块

在VBA编辑器中,选择 插入 -> 模块 ,插入一个新的模块。

2.3 编写代码

在模块中输入以下代码:

Sub InsertPictureFromURL()  

    Dim picURL As String  
    Dim rng As Range  
    Dim pic As Picture  
    '定义图片URL和插入位置  
    picURL = Range("A1").Value '假设A1单元格中存放的是图片URL  
    Set rng = Range("B1") '图片显示位置  
    '插入图片  
    Set pic = ActiveSheet.Pictures.Insert(picURL)  
    With pic  
        .ShapeRange.LockAspectRatio = msoTrue  
        .Top = rng.Top  
        .Left = rng.Left  
        .Width = rng.Width  
        .Height = rng.Height  
    End With  
End Sub  

2.4 运行代码

返回Excel表格,按下 Alt + F8 打开“宏”对话框,选择 InsertPictureFromURL 宏并运行。此时,图片将被插入到指定位置。

三、插入对象

通过插入对象的方法,您可以将超链接的图片直接嵌入到Excel中。以下是详细步骤:

3.1 插入对象

选择 插入 -> 对象 ,在弹出的对话框中选择 由文件创建 选项卡。

3.2 输入文件链接

在文件路径框中输入图片的URL,确保选中 链接到文件 选项。

3.3 确定插入

点击 确定 按钮,图片将被插入到Excel中。

四、总结

使用公式与函数、使用VBA代码、插入对象是三种在Excel中直接显示超链接图片的方法。使用公式与函数是最为简便的方法,尤其是在最新版本的Excel中,通过IMAGE函数可以轻松实现动态图片显示。而使用VBA代码提供了更为灵活和强大的功能,适用于复杂的自动化任务。插入对象的方法虽然较为简单,但适用于单一或少量图片的插入需求。根据实际需求选择合适的方法,可以极大地提高Excel表格的可视化效果和数据展示能力。

相关问答FAQs:

1. 如何在Excel中直接显示超链接的图片?

  • 问题:我想在Excel中直接显示一个超链接的图片,该怎么做?

  • 回答:您可以按照以下步骤在Excel中直接显示超链接的图片:

  1. 首先,将您要插入的超链接复制到剪贴板中。

  2. 在Excel中,选择要插入图片的单元格。

  3. 单击“插入”选项卡上的“图片”按钮。

  4. 在“插入图片”对话框中,选择“剪贴画”选项。

  5. 在“剪贴画”工具栏上,单击“从剪贴板”按钮。

  6. Excel将自动将剪贴板中的超链接作为图片插入到所选单元格中。

2. 如何在Excel中将超链接和图片结合显示?

  • 问题:我想在Excel中将超链接和图片结合显示,该怎么做呢?

  • 回答:您可以按照以下步骤在Excel中将超链接和图片结合显示:

  1. 首先,将您要插入的图片复制到剪贴板中。

  2. 在Excel中,选择要插入超链接和图片的单元格。

  3. 单击“插入”选项卡上的“超链接”按钮。

  4. 在“超链接”对话框中,将您想要链接的URL粘贴到“地址”框中。

  5. 单击“确定”按钮,将超链接插入到单元格中。

  6. 然后,按照第一条回答中的步骤将图片插入到相同的单元格中。

3. 在Excel中如何使用超链接显示网页图片?

  • 问题:我希望在Excel中能够显示网页上的图片,并通过超链接进行访问,该怎么做?

  • 回答:您可以按照以下步骤在Excel中使用超链接显示网页图片:

  1. 首先,找到您想要显示的网页上的图片。

  2. 在网页上,右键单击图片并选择“复制图像地址”选项。

  3. 在Excel中,选择要插入超链接和图片的单元格。

  4. 单击“插入”选项卡上的“超链接”按钮。

  5. 在“超链接”对话框中,将您在步骤2中复制的图像地址粘贴到“地址”框中。

  6. 单击“确定”按钮,将超链接插入到单元格中。

  7. 然后,按照第一条回答中的步骤将图片插入到相同的单元格中。

© 2023 北京元石科技有限公司 ◎ 京公网安备 11010802042949号